Behavior
In experiment group, The intervention included a care training program to the caring person held in 4 consecutive days
each session took 50 to 60 minutes. Making sure that trained people could properly take care of the patients, they were asked to serve the patients at their homes for four weeks.
Control group, simply received the routine trainings while discharge.

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Inclusion criteria: patient’s consent; recognizing hemiplegic stroke in patients by doctors; no mental disorders, no drug abuse; full consciousness and being able to answer the questions. Exclusion criteria; cutting the cooperation at any moment Prematurely patient discharge or death.
